Pain is an uncomfortable sensation, It is entirely based on subjective sensory and emotional experience, meaning that for one person it will hurt a lot more than for another person. Pain is usually associated with potential or actual tissue damagE

Each individual experiences pain in a different way and the pain can be severe on one person and less severe on the next one .

Pain is subjective therefor the pain experienced by one person in note equal that which another person may feel. 

Pain varies from acute pain to Chronic pain.

Acute pain happens in the skin bone, joint ,muscle, connective tissues or it may also take place in the visceral : internal organs; e.g large intestine and pancreas. 

whilst during Chronic pain it may take place via the functional which is the fibromyalgia,Ibs, tension type headache or pain can be seen in the Neuropathic where the nerve is damaged also during post neuralgia and diabetic neuropathy.
